#f8f645 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f8f645 is composed of 97.3% red, 96.5%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.8% magenta, 72.2%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 59.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 62.2%. #f8f645 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8a with #f1ed00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

Shades and Tints of #f8f645

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030300 is the darkest color, while #fefeef is the lightest one.

Tones of #f8f645

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9f9e is the less saturated color, while #f8f645 is the most saturated one.
